博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
使用mingw(fedora)移植virt-viewer
阅读量:4202 次
发布时间:2019-05-26

本文共 1007 字,大约阅读时间需要 3 分钟。

一、mingw on fedora
1. 安装mingw软件包
    安装所有:
     
yum install mingw32-\*
    
     最少需要:
  • mingw32-binutils
  • mingw32-cpp
  • mingw32-filesystem
  • mingw32-gcc
  • mingw32-gcc-c++
  • mingw32-runtime
  • mingw32-w32api
2. 安装必要的工具:
    
yum groupinstall "Development Tools"
3. 配置wine — 用来执行win32的可执行文件
    yum install wine
二、移植
#1. 生成configure等文件
#./autogen.sh  
官网上下载的已经有configure文件
2. 配置
ming32-configure
3. 安装
mingw32-make
mingw32-make install
4 制作windows安装文件
添加环境变量:
export PATH=$PATH:/usr/i686-w64-mingw32/sys-root/mingw/bin/:/usr/lib/wine/fakedlls/
nsiswrapper --run --name "Virt-Viewer" --outfile "Virt-Viewer-for-Windows.exe" --with-gtk /usr/i686-w64-mingw32/sys-root/mingw/bin/remote-viewer.exe
cp /virt-viewer/virt-viewer-0.5.4/src/*.xml /usr/i686-w64-mingw32/sys-root/mingw/bin/
nsiswrapper /usr/i686-w64-mingw32/sys-root/mingw/bin/remote-viewer.exe /usr/i686-w64-mingw32/sys-root/mingw/bin/*.xml --run --name "Virt-Viewer" --outfile "Virt-Viewer-for-Windows.exe" --with-gtk
另一种方法: 一般会出现文件不匹配,修改virt-viewer.nsis文件跟自己系统相同即可
makensis  data/virt-viewer.nsis

转载地址:http://bovli.baihongyu.com/

你可能感兴趣的文章
《QTP自动化测试实践》要出第二版了!
查看>>
用LoadRunner开发开心网外挂
查看>>
QTP测试.NET控件CheckedListBox
查看>>
使用QTP的.NET插件扩展技术测试ComponentOne的ToolBar控件
查看>>
用上帝之眼进行自动化测试
查看>>
为LoadRunner写一个lr_save_float函数
查看>>
PrefTest工作室全新力作-《性能测试与调优实战》课程视频即将上线
查看>>
质量度量分析与测试技术 培训大纲
查看>>
欢迎加入【亿能测试快讯】邮件列表!
查看>>
为什么我们的自动化测试“要”这么难
查看>>
LoadRunner性能脚本开发实战训练
查看>>
测试之途,前途?钱途?图何?
查看>>
测试设计与测试项目实战训练
查看>>
HP Sprinter:敏捷加速器
查看>>
单元测试培训PPT
查看>>
adb常用命令
查看>>
通过LR监控Linux服务器性能
查看>>
通过FTP服务的winsockes录制脚本
查看>>
LRwinsocket协议测试AAA服务器
查看>>
Net远程管理实验
查看>>